How do we project donations if our congregation's attendance fluctuates?

The model uses historical giving-per-attendee averages combined with low, medium, and high attendance scenarios to project a realistic revenue range. This allows you to plan your base budget around conservative estimates while earmarking surplus funds for secondary projects if attendance rises.

What is a healthy cash reserve for a mid-sized faith organization?

Most healthy ministries aim to maintain a reserve equal to three to six months of core operational expenses. This buffer ensures that staff payroll and facility costs are fully covered even during low-giving seasons or unexpected emergency repairs.

How should we account for designated or restricted giving in our budget?

Restricted gifts must be tracked in separate columns within the model to ensure they are only allocated to their specified projects, like youth missions or building funds. The model calculates your operational budget using unrestricted general funds, keeping restricted assets isolated to prevent accidental overspending.
